Agencies have been tasked by the Trump administration to take their customer service up a notch. But a few things may stand in the way, like budget uncertainty, and in some agencies less-than-optimal relations between line employees and management. Bob Tobias is a professor in the Key Executive Leadership Program at American University and he joined Federal Drive with Tom Temin to argue that better services starts in-house.
